The National Testing Agency (NTA) successfully conducted the Preliminary Exam (Phase 1) for the esteemed position of Examiner of Patents and Designs against 553 vacancies under the DR quota in the Patent Office. This initial phase took place on 21 December 2023 (Thursday) across 260 centers in 103 cities throughout the country, witnessing a participation of around 89,657 candidates.

Eligibility for Mains Examination
Candidates who qualify for the Preliminary Exam (Phase 1) will advance to the next stage – the Mains Examination, consisting of Paper I and Paper II.
Mains Examination Schedule
Level of Exam | Type | Subject | Expected Date | Mode of Exam |
---|---|---|---|---|
Mains Paper-I | Computer Based Test | – | 25 January 2024 (Thursday) in the First Shift | Offline |
Mains Paper-II | Descriptive Test | 14 different disciplines | 25 January 2024 (Thursday) in the Second Shift | To be announced later on the website |
Mains Examination Details
Mains Paper-I
- Total Marks: 100
- Duration: 2 hours
Mains Paper-II
- Total Marks: 300
- Duration: 3 hours
- Subjects:
- General Knowledge and Current Affairs (20 Marks)
- General Aptitude (20 Marks)
- Elementary mathematics (20 Marks)
- English language proficiency (20 Marks)
- Knowledge related to intellectual property rights (IPRs) (20 Marks)
- Technical/scientific discipline of the vacancy applied for.
Interview Process
Following the Mains Examination, candidates will proceed to the interview stage. The mode of this phase will be announced later on the official website.
